At the recent 137th Canton Fair, cross transfer conveyors really stole the limelight! It's fascinating to see how they’re shaping the manufacturing scene in China. One major trend that stood out is how manufacturers are diving headfirst into advanced tech, like automation and IoT. Seriously, they’re adding smart features to their conveyor systems that let them monitor everything in real-time. This not only boosts efficiency but also cuts down on downtime—pretty impressive, right? It’s not just about making operations smoother; it’s also about catering to a wider range of industries that are looking for custom solutions.
But that's not all! Another big trend that caught everyone's attention is the push for sustainability in conveyor manufacturing. A lot of manufacturers in China are making eco-friendly materials and energy-efficient designs a priority, which aligns pretty nicely with global sustainability standards. This shift isn't just responding to the increasing call for greener alternatives; it’s also part of a bigger commitment to reducing the environmental footprint of industrial operations. As companies aim to meet stricter regulations and the expectations of conscious consumers, it’s clear that sustainability is going to play a huge role in the future of cross transfer conveyor production in the Chinese market.

You know, as industries keep changing, there’s this growing need for efficient and reliable materials handling solutions. The 138th Canton Fair is just around the corner, and it’s a fantastic chance for manufacturers of cross transfer conveyors to show off their products to a global audience. I came across this interesting report by MarketsandMarkets that says the global conveyor system market is projected to jump from USD 7.1 billion in 2021 to around USD 9.5 billion by 2026. Pretty impressive, right? This really goes to show just how much companies are relying on advanced logistics and automation across different sectors—think manufacturing, food processing, and mining, just to name a few.
